Abstract :
A novel procedure for damage identiÞcation of framed structures is proposed, where both the location and the extent of structural damage in framed structures can be correctly determined using only a limited number of measured natural frequencies. No knowledge of the modal shapes of the damaged structure is required. On the basis of the characteristic equations for the original and the damaged structure, a set of equations is generated. Two computational techniques, the direct iteration (DI) technique and the GaussÐNewton least-squares (GNLS) technique, are utilized to determine structural damage from the derived equations. Finally, di¤erent numerical examples are used to demonstrate the e¤ectiveness of the proposed method
